aboutsummaryrefslogtreecommitdiffstats
path: root/qv4isel_llvm.cpp
diff options
context:
space:
mode:
authorErik Verbruggen <erik.verbruggen@digia.com>2012-12-18 09:06:03 +0100
committerSimon Hausmann <simon.hausmann@digia.com>2012-12-18 10:19:16 +0100
commit1014d1fb1cfa2d44d6d3fdb51dfb93b736e7fc26 (patch)
tree22378085b2025368aeaf0b88fd860431bc46cb53 /qv4isel_llvm.cpp
parent0f1203b8b12d19386e16945171b727a271cf3e6d (diff)
More compilation fixes.
Change-Id: I5940e0b1e72c06420ae95ff3adfd78572888c886 Reviewed-by: Simon Hausmann <simon.hausmann@digia.com>
Diffstat (limited to 'qv4isel_llvm.cpp')
-rw-r--r--qv4isel_llvm.cpp5
1 files changed, 5 insertions, 0 deletions
diff --git a/qv4isel_llvm.cpp b/qv4isel_llvm.cpp
index 5ea5df9d58..eea515cdea 100644
--- a/qv4isel_llvm.cpp
+++ b/qv4isel_llvm.cpp
@@ -780,6 +780,11 @@ void LLVMInstructionSelection::genBinop(llvm::Value *result, IR::Binop *e)
Q_UNREACHABLE();
break;
+ case IR::OpIncrement:
+ case IR::OpDecrement:
+ assert(!"TODO!");
+ break;
+
case IR::OpBitAnd: op = _llvmModule->getFunction("__qmljs_llvm_bit_and"); break;
case IR::OpBitOr: op = _llvmModule->getFunction("__qmljs_llvm_bit_or"); break;
case IR::OpBitXor: op = _llvmModule->getFunction("__qmljs_llvm_bit_xor"); break;